Colleague Services Shuttle Driver - Jobs in Lake Louise, Alberta

Job LocationLake Louise, Alberta

Job DescriptionAs a member of the Colleague Services team, the colleague shuttle driver provides transportation services for the 800 Staff Residents living on site at Fairmont Chateau Lake Louise. This is an ideal role for a community focused individual; hosting residents on the shuttle, and providing transportation and lifestyle support, while completing daily tasks. The colleague shuttle driver is an essential component of our mission for all residents: To provide the best possible living experience on property.What you will be doing:

  • Delivering engaging and welcoming service.
  • Operating the staff shuttle between the Chateau Lake Louise and the village of Lake Louise, the Lake Louise ski hill, Canmore, Banff, and Calgary.
  • Maintaining the cleanliness of the staff shuttle.
  • Completing daily routine maintenance reports for the staff shuttle and alerting management of any issues or concerns that need to be attended to.
  • Completing weekly inspections of the colleague services additional vehicles (between 3 and 6 vehicles) ensuring vehicles are cleaned, maintained, and are not in need of repair. Reporting any issues to Colleague Services Management team.
  • Assisting with mail duties, including picking up mail deliveries from the village of Lake Louise post office for all 800 residents, delivering to staff services in upper Lake Louise, and assisting the Colleague Services team in processing mail.
  • Assisting the Colleague Services team with the arrival of new staff members; picking up from town or the main hotel entrance, conducting a property tour, assisting with luggage and transportation to their unit.
  • Assist Colleague Services with miscellaneous tasks including: moving furniture, cleaning Colleague Services grounds, vacuuming, and other light duties as assigned.
  • Comply with all department policies, procedures, and service standards
  • Follow and proactively promote all health and safety policies and initiatives
